The Steering Committee investigating options for Producer Payment Security Mechanisms released the final report by Scott Wolfe Management today. The objective of the project was to examine payment security options as a result of the proposed changes to the Canada Grain Act affecting the payment security program under the Canadian Grain Commission. Four options, including the current system, were studied by Scott Wolfe Management, the consulting firm hired to conduct the research. The options included the following models: security-based, insurance-based, fund-based, and clearinghouse.
The steering committee includes representatives from general farm organizations, commodity groups and a trade association. Agriculture and Agri-Food Canada through its Private Sector Risk Management Partnerships Program provided funding for the study. Steering committee members contributed their time and financial resources to the project.
The organizations involved in the committee will now seek feedback from their membership. This will include what the next steps will be in further developing one or more of the options, including refining the current payment security program.
The study consisted of an analysis on the payment security options, highlighting the relative strengths and weaknesses of each.The English report is available here along with the appendices. The French versions will be available in the coming weeks.
